Skip to content

Commit

Permalink
NOISSUE - Docs for domains , groups, channel, things relationship (#174)
Browse files Browse the repository at this point in the history
* Add: docs for domains & groups relationship

Signed-off-by: Arvindh <[email protected]>

* add: empty line at end file

Signed-off-by: Arvindh <[email protected]>

* add: group docs

Signed-off-by: Arvindh <[email protected]>

* fix authorization.md

Signed-off-by: Arvindh <[email protected]>

* fix authorization.md

Signed-off-by: Arvindh <[email protected]>

* fix authorization.md

Signed-off-by: Arvindh <[email protected]>

* fix authorization.md

Signed-off-by: Arvindh <[email protected]>

* fix: grammers, case,  and wordings

Signed-off-by: Arvindh <[email protected]>

* update: drawio diagrams

Signed-off-by: Arvindh <[email protected]>

* fix: grammers, case,  and wordings

Signed-off-by: Arvindh <[email protected]>

* fix capitalization

Signed-off-by: Arvindh <[email protected]>

* fix grammer

Signed-off-by: Arvindh <[email protected]>

* fix grammer

Signed-off-by: Arvindh <[email protected]>

* fix grammer

Signed-off-by: Arvindh <[email protected]>

* fix grammer

Signed-off-by: Arvindh <[email protected]>

---------

Signed-off-by: Arvindh <[email protected]>
  • Loading branch information
arvindh123 authored Mar 21, 2024
1 parent 16bb5a9 commit e51af36
Show file tree
Hide file tree
Showing 25 changed files with 6,510 additions and 692 deletions.
698 changes: 504 additions & 194 deletions docs/authorization.md

Large diffs are not rendered by default.

181 changes: 0 additions & 181 deletions docs/diagrams/domain_group_user4_step_1.drawio

This file was deleted.

197 changes: 0 additions & 197 deletions docs/diagrams/domain_group_user4_step_2.drawio

This file was deleted.

141 changes: 141 additions & 0 deletions docs/diagrams/domain_users.drawio
Original file line number Diff line number Diff line change
@@ -0,0 +1,141 @@
<mxfile host="65bd71144e">
<diagram id="6mOy798XpB74Yk2sk_v2" name="Page-1">
<mxGraphModel dx="3352" dy="2516" grid="1" gridSize="10" guides="1" tooltips="1" connect="1" arrows="1" fold="1" page="1" pageScale="1" pageWidth="850" pageHeight="1100" math="0" shadow="0">
<root>
<mxCell id="0"/>
<mxCell id="1" style="locked=1;" parent="0"/>
<mxCell id="4" value="Domain_1_container" style="locked=1;" parent="0"/>
<mxCell id="5" value="&lt;font style=&quot;font-size: 30px;&quot;&gt;&lt;b style=&quot;&quot;&gt;domain_1&lt;/b&gt;&lt;/font&gt;" style="rounded=1;whiteSpace=wrap;html=1;verticalAlign=top;" parent="4" vertex="1">
<mxGeometry x="-550" y="-40" width="1580" height="880" as="geometry"/>
</mxCell>
<mxCell id="6" value="Domain_1_entities" style="locked=1;" parent="0"/>
<mxCell id="8" value="group_1"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="90" y="240"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="22"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;entryX=0.281;entryY=0.988;entryDx=0;entryDy=0;fontSize=20;fillColor=#a20025;strokeColor=#6F0000;strokeWidth=4;entryPerimeter=0;" parent="6" source="10" target="8" edge="1">
<mxGeometry relative="1" as="geometry">
<Array as="points">
<mxPoint x="10" y="320"/>
</Array>
</mxGeometry>
</mxCell>
<mxCell id="10" value="group_12" style="rounded=1;whiteSpace=wrap;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-230" y="370"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="20" style="edgeStyle=elbowEdgeStyle;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;elbow=vertical;fillColor=#1ba1e2;strokeColor=#006EAF;strokeWidth=4;" parent="6" source="11" target="10"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="11" value="channel_2"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-390" y="510"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="21"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;fontSize=20;fillColor=#1ba1e2;strokeColor=#006EAF;strokeWidth=4;" parent="6" source="12" target="10"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="12" value="channel_3"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-70" y="510"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="23"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;fontSize=20;fillColor=#1ba1e2;strokeColor=#006EAF;strokeWidth=4;entryX=0.75;entryY=1;entryDx=0;entryDy=0;" parent="6" source="14" target="8" edge="1">
<mxGeometry relative="1" as="geometry">
<mxPoint x="170" y="280" as="targetPoint"/>
</mxGeometry>
</mxCell>
<mxCell id="14" value="channel_1"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="410" y="360"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="18" style="edgeStyle=none;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;fillColor=#6a00ff;strokeColor=#3700CC;strokeWidth=4;" parent="6" source="15" target="14" edge="1">
<mxGeometry relative="1" as="geometry">
<Array as="points">
<mxPoint x="330" y="450"/>
<mxPoint x="490" y="450"/>
</Array>
</mxGeometry>
</mxCell>
<mxCell id="15" value="thing_11"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="250" y="500"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="19" style="edgeStyle=none;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;fillColor=#6a00ff;strokeColor=#3700CC;strokeWidth=4;" parent="6" source="16" target="14" edge="1">
<mxGeometry relative="1" as="geometry">
<Array as="points">
<mxPoint x="650" y="450"/>
<mxPoint x="490" y="450"/>
</Array>
</mxGeometry>
</mxCell>
<mxCell id="16" value="thing_12" style="rounded=1;html=1;fontSize=25;strokeWidth=4;" parent="6" vertex="1">
<mxGeometry x="570" y="500"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="29"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;strokeWidth=4;fillColor=#6a00ff;strokeColor=#3700CC;" parent="6" source="25" target="11"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="25" value="thing_21"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-510" y="630"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="30"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;strokeWidth=4;" parent="6" source="26" target="11"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="26" value="thing_22"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-270" y="630"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="28"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;fontSize=20;fillColor=#6a00ff;strokeColor=#3700CC;strokeWidth=4;" parent="6" source="27" target="12"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="27" value="thing_31"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="-70" y="630"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="32"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;fontSize=20;fillColor=#6a00ff;strokeColor=#3700CC;strokeWidth=4;" parent="6" edge="1">
<mxGeometry relative="1" as="geometry">
<mxPoint x="-190" y="630" as="sourcePoint"/>
<mxPoint x="-310" y="550" as="targetPoint"/>
</mxGeometry>
</mxCell>
<mxCell id="61" value="group_2"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="840" y="240"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="64"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;strokeColor=#006EAF;fontSize=25;startArrow=none;startFill=0;endArrow=classic;endFill=1;fillColor=#1ba1e2;strokeWidth=4;" parent="6" source="63" target="61"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="63" value="channel_4"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="840" y="340"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="66" style="edgeStyle=elbowEdgeStyle;rounded=1;elbow=vertical;html=1;entryX=0.5;entryY=1;entryDx=0;entryDy=0;strokeColor=#3700CC;fontSize=25;startArrow=none;startFill=0;endArrow=classic;endFill=1;fillColor=#6a00ff;strokeWidth=4;" parent="6" source="65" target="63" edge="1">
<mxGeometry relative="1" as="geometry"/>
</mxCell>
<mxCell id="65" value="thing_41" style="rounded=1;html=1;fontSize=25;" parent="6" vertex="1">
<mxGeometry x="840" y="440" width="160" height="40" as="geometry"/>
</mxCell>
<mxCell id="39" value="Domain_1_Users" style="locked=1;" parent="0"/>
<mxCell id="76" value="Legends" style="locked=1;" parent="0"/>
<mxCell id="77" value="Legends" style="text;html=1;strokeColor=none;fillColor=none;align=center;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=25;" parent="76" vertex="1">
<mxGeometry x="555" y="620" width="150" height="30" as="geometry"/>
</mxCell>
<mxCell id="80" value="" style="endArrow=none;startArrow=classic;html=1;rounded=1;strokeColor=#6F0000;fontSize=25;startFill=1;endFill=0;fillColor=#a20025;strokeWidth=4;" parent="76" edge="1">
<mxGeometry width="50" height="50" relative="1" as="geometry">
<mxPoint x="570" y="670" as="sourcePoint"/>
<mxPoint x="450" y="670" as="targetPoint"/>
</mxGeometry>
</mxCell>
<mxCell id="81" value="" style="endArrow=none;startArrow=classic;html=1;rounded=1;strokeColor=#006EAF;fontSize=25;startFill=1;endFill=0;fillColor=#1ba1e2;strokeWidth=4;" parent="76" edge="1">
<mxGeometry width="50" height="50" relative="1" as="geometry">
<mxPoint x="570" y="710" as="sourcePoint"/>
<mxPoint x="450" y="710" as="targetPoint"/>
</mxGeometry>
</mxCell>
<mxCell id="82" value="" style="endArrow=none;startArrow=classic;html=1;rounded=1;strokeColor=#3700CC;fontSize=25;startFill=1;endFill=0;fillColor=#6a00ff;strokeWidth=4;" parent="76" edge="1">
<mxGeometry width="50" height="50" relative="1" as="geometry">
<mxPoint x="570" y="750" as="sourcePoint"/>
<mxPoint x="450" y="750" as="targetPoint"/>
</mxGeometry>
</mxCell>
<mxCell id="86" value="Group - Group Relation" style="text;html=1;strokeColor=none;fillColor=none;align=left;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=25;" parent="76" vertex="1">
<mxGeometry x="580" y="650" width="300" height="30" as="geometry"/>
</mxCell>
<mxCell id="87" value="Channel- Group Relation" style="text;html=1;strokeColor=none;fillColor=none;align=left;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=25;" parent="76" vertex="1">
<mxGeometry x="580" y="690" width="300" height="30" as="geometry"/>
</mxCell>
<mxCell id="88" value="Thing - Channel Relation" style="text;html=1;strokeColor=none;fillColor=none;align=left;verticalAlign=middle;whiteSpace=wrap;rounded=0;fontSize=25;" parent="76" vertex="1">
<mxGeometry x="580" y="730" width="300" height="30" as="geometry"/>
</mxCell>
</root>
</mxGraphModel>
</diagram>
</mxfile>
Loading

0 comments on commit e51af36

Please sign in to comment.